Pickleball ratings are a system for categorizing players by skill level and proficiency. Ratings range from 2.0 (beginner) to 7.0 (professional). These ratings serve several purposes within the pickleball community:
Skill Assessment: Ratings provide an objective measure of a player’s skill level, helping players and organizers better understand their abilities on the court.
Matchmaking: In tournaments and organized play, players with similar ratings are often matched to ensure fair, competitive games. This enhances the overall experience for all participants.
Player Improvement: Ratings offer players a clear benchmark for improvement. As players progress in skill, their ratings can be adjusted to reflect their evolving abilities.
Event Eligibility: Certain tournaments and events may have entry requirements based on player ratings. This ensures that participants are evenly matched, contributing to a more competitive and enjoyable atmosphere.
Community Standardization: Ratings contribute to a standardized language within the pickleball community. Players and organizers across different regions can use ratings as a common reference point when discussing skill levels.

Dynamic Universal Pickleball Rating (DUPR)
The most accurate global rating system based on match results against other rated players.
How to get started:
- Create a free account at mydupr.com
- Join the EPC Club on DUPR
- Record scores from EPC rated plays
We will accept your DUPR rating and will assign you a club rating by rounding down your DUPR score pending a reliability score of 60 or higher.

Common Questions
Can I self-rate to join a 3.5 program?
No. To maintain game quality, any program listed as 3.0 or higher requires a verified rating from DUPR, Pickleball Alberta, or Pickleball Brackets.
What if my DUPR is 3.45? Am I a 3.0 or 3.5?
EPC rounds down to ensure you are playing at the top of your bracket rather than the bottom. A 3.45 would play in the 3.0 intermediate bracket until you reach a 3.50.
How do I update my rating after a tournament?
Simply send a screenshot of your updated Pickleball Alberta or PB Brackets profile to our staff, and we will update your EPC account within 48 hours.
Do you offer official skill evaluations?
Yes! Our staff pros offer 60-minute evaluation sessions where they assess your technical skills and match play to issue a club-verified rating.
